Understanding the difficult airway society algorithm
The difficult airway society algorithm is a systematic approach that helps healthcare providers assess and manage patients with difficult airways. It consists of a series of steps that guide clinicians through the assessment, decision-making, and intervention process. The algorithm is designed to ensure that healthcare providers have a standardized approach to airway management, leading to better patient safety and outcomes.
The difficult airway society algorithm is divided into several key components:
1. Assessment: The first step in the algorithm is to assess the patient’s airway. This involves evaluating factors such as the patient’s anatomy, medical history, and potential risk factors for difficult intubation. By conducting a thorough assessment, healthcare providers can identify patients who may require special considerations during airway management.
2. Decision-making: Once the patient’s airway has been assessed, healthcare providers must make decisions about the appropriate course of action. This may involve determining the best approach to intubation, selecting the appropriate equipment, and deciding on the appropriate level of sedation or anesthesia.
3. Intervention: The final step in the algorithm is to intervene to secure the patient’s airway. This may involve using techniques such as direct laryngoscopy, video laryngoscopy, or fiber-optic bronchoscopy to successfully intubate the patient. Healthcare providers must be prepared to adapt their approach based on the patient’s specific airway anatomy and potential challenges.
Key Considerations in Airway Management
When navigating the difficult airway society algorithm, healthcare providers must consider several key factors to ensure successful airway management:
1. Patient factors: Healthcare providers must consider factors such as the patient’s age, weight, medical history, and potential risk factors for difficult intubation. Certain patient populations, such as those with obstructive sleep apnea or cervical spine injuries, may require special considerations during airway management.
2. Equipment selection: Selecting the appropriate equipment is crucial for successful airway management. Healthcare providers must ensure that they have access to a range of airway devices, such as endotracheal tubes, laryngoscopes, and airway adjuncts, to effectively manage difficult airway situations.
3. Team communication: Effective communication among healthcare providers is essential during airway management. Clear communication helps ensure that all team members are aligned on the plan of action and can quickly adapt to changing circumstances during the procedure.
4. Training and expertise: Healthcare providers must have the necessary training and expertise in airway management techniques to successfully navigate difficult airway situations. Regular training and simulation exercises can help healthcare providers hone their skills and ensure optimal patient outcomes.
